ALUMNI PROMINENT AT MEETING

Dean Briggs Re-elected Head of Collegiate Athletic Association.

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

At the morning session of the ninth annual convention of the National Collegiate Athletic Association in the La Salle Hotel, Chicago, Coach P. D. Haughton '99, who, with P. Withington '09, and F. W. Moore '92, represented the University, spoke on "Mental Training in Football," stating that the man with brains, regardless of size, was the most in demand in the present game. Professor C. W. Savage '98, of Oberlin, read a paper on "Professionalism versus Amateurism.

Reports from the delegates of the various districts and the election of the rules committees for the different sports occupied the afternoon session, P. With-ington '09, being elected chairman of the rules committee for intercollegiate swimming. Dean Briggs was re-elected president of the association and Professor Frank Walter Nicolson '57, of Wesleyan University, secretary-treasurer for the coming year.
